Local Radar
Is your parade about to get rained on? Local Radar makes interpreting NOAA radar weather maps a snap. Local Radar repositions NOAA radar composite images so your current position is centered in the map.
The red dot in the center of the map marks your current location so you can always tell at a glance where the weather is relative to where you are.
Local Radar does only one thing, but it does it very simply and very well.
Radar coverage area includes the lower 48 states. Coverage for Hawaii, Puerto Rico and parts of Alaska coming soon. Local Radar maps are updated every 10 minutes.
